Around 10 o'clock on Nov 30, Brian Stell wrote:
> > + What basic signalling mechanism should be used
>
> Probably a property event off the root window.
That would work if everything related to fonts was an X application, and
all of them were connected to the same display.
I'd like to solve the simple problem where all applications are running on
the same machine; it seems like there should be some OS mechanism that
will work for this.
> If a font in added (eg: downloaded via a browser) would the
> user need to log off for the X server / Xfs to see it?
If the X server and Xfs shared the same font configuration mechanism as
Xft, then they'd get updated information via the same route. Right now,
you can install new fonts, re-run 'mkfontdir' and then 'xset fp rehash'
and the X server will see the new fonts.
